Liberty Storage
Advertisement
22024 E Liberty Rd
Acampo, CA 95220
Liberty Storage is the go-to RV and boat storage provider in Clements, CA. See what parking we have available and how we can help meet your needs!
Also at this address
See a problem?
You might also like
Advertisement
